Reporting to the owner/manager, this role will involve managing the Northam Precision Farming sales for Boekeman Machinery, with the option for other potential locations within the Wheatbelt. This role includes building and maintaining customer relationships and providing support to Precision Farming Technicians and Sales Consultants.
Primary respon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
- Manage Precision Farming parts stock, including pricing and availability information, stock takes, tracking parts, etc.
- Discuss, quote, sell and fit products and services.
- Be the first level of phone support for customers, ensuring prompt replies.
- Develop and maintain customer support documentation - manuals, guides, etc.
- Plan and coordinate customer training days before the season.
- Work closely with salespeople on product compatibility and requirements.
- Check and calibrate new and used precision farming items before issuing.
- Attend any in-house sales, marketing or AFS training days.
- Call on farms to solicit new and existing businesses to generate sales.
